Delinquent : A Mortgage Loan is “Delinquent” if any payment due thereon is not made pursuant to the terms of such Mortgage Loan by the close of business on the day such payment is scheduled to be due. A Mortgage Loan is “30 days delinquent” if such payment has not been received by the close of business on the last day of the month immediately succeeding the month in which such payment was due. For example, a Mortgage Loan with a payment due on December 1 that remained unpaid as of the close of business on January 31 would then be considered to be 30 to 59 days delinquent. Similarly for “60 days delinquent,” “90 days delinquent” and so on.

Senior Prepayment Percentage : With respect to Loan Group II and any Distribution Date occurring during the periods set forth below, as follows:

Period (dates inclusive)

Senior Prepayment Percentage

 

 

September 2005 – August 2012

100%

 

 

September 2012 – August 2013

Senior Percentage plus 70% of the Subordinate Percentage.

 

 

September 2013 – August 2014

Senior Percentage plus 60% of the Subordinate Percentage.

 

 

September 2014 – August 2015

Senior Percentage plus 40% of the Subordinate Percentage.

 

 

September 2015 – August 2016

Senior Percentage plus 20% of the Subordinate Percentage.

 

 

September 2016 and thereafter

Senior Percentage.

 

 

In addition, no reduction of the Senior Prepayment Percentage for the related Certificate Group shall occur on any Distribution Date unless, as of the last day of the month preceding such Distribution Date, (A) the aggregate Stated Principal Balance of the Group II Mortgage Loans delinquent 60 days or more (including for this purpose any such Group II Mortgage Loans in foreclosure and Group II Mortgage Loans with respect to which the related Mortgaged Property has been acquired by the Trust), averaged over the last six months, as a percentage of the sum of the aggregate Certificate Principal Balance of the Group II Subordinate Certificates does not exceed 50%; and (B) cumulative Realized Losses on the Group II Mortgage Loans do not exceed (a) 30% of the Original Group II Subordinate Principal Balance if such Distribution Date occurs between and including September 2012 and August 2013, (b) 35% of the Original Group II Subordinate Principal Balance if such Distribution Date occurs between and including

 

54

 

 


 

September 2013 and August 2014, (c) 40% of the Original Group II Subordinate Principal Balance if such Distribution Date occurs between and including September 2014 and August 2015, (d) 45% of the Original Group II Subordinate Principal Balance if such Distribution Date occurs between and including September 2015 and August 2016, and (e) 50% of the Original Group II Subordinate Principal Balance if such Distribution Date occurs during or after September 2016.

In addition, if on any Distribution Date the Subordinate Percentage for such Distribution Date is equal to or greater than two times the initial Subordinate Percentage, and (a) the aggregate Stated Principal Balance of the Group II Mortgage Loans delinquent 60 days or more (including for this purpose any such Mortgage Loans in foreclosure and such Group II Mortgage Loans with respect to which the related Mortgaged Property has been acquired by the Trust), averaged over the last six months, as a percentage of the aggregate Certificate Principal Balance of the Group II Subordinate Certificates does not exceed 50% and (b)(i) on or prior to the Distribution Date in August 2008, cumulative Realized Losses on the Group II Mortgage Loans as of the end of the related Prepayment Period do not exceed 20% of the Original Group II Subordinate Principal Balance and (ii) after the Distribution Date in August 2008 cumulative Realized Losses on the Group II Mortgage Loans as of the end of the related Prepayment Period do not exceed 30% of the Original Group II Subordinate Principal Balance, then, the Senior Prepayment Percentage for such Distribution Date will equal the Senior Percentage for the related Certificate Group; provided , however , if on such Distribution Date the Subordinate Percentage is equal to or greater than two times the initial Subordinate Percentage on or prior to the Distribution Date occurring in August 2008 and the above delinquency and loss tests are met, then the Senior Prepayment Percentage for the related Certificate Group for such Distribution Date will equal the related Senior Percentage plus 50% of the related Subordinate Percentage.

Notwithstanding the foregoing, if on any Distribution Date the percentage, the numerator of which is the aggregate Certificate Principal Balance of the Group II Senior Certificates immediately preceding such Distribution Date, and the denominator of which is the Stated Principal Balance of the Group II Mortgage Loans as of the beginning of the related Due Period, exceeds such percentage as of the Cut-Off Date, the Senior Prepayment Percentage for the Senior Certificates will equal 100%.
